The Hells Angels Motorcycle Club was founded in Fontana, California, near San Bernardino, in 1948. Criminal Intelligence Service Canada describes the Hells Angels as the largest "outlaw motorcycle gang" in the country, with active chapters concentrated mostlyin Quebec, Ontario and British Columbia. The Lennoxville massacre, or Lennoxville purge, was a mass murder which took place at the Hells Angels clubhouse in Sherbrooke, Quebec, Canada, on March 24, 1985.
